Methadone is a regulated drug utilized for the reduction of harm associated with opiate addiction. A person who wants to stop abusing heroin or prescription pain killers can get enrolled into a methadone program in or near Hoboken where they ingest it daily to stop withdrawal, avoid cravings and basically substitute their addiction with a legal medication. Many individuals who begin methadone maintenance treatment remain on the drug for many years, due to the fact that withdrawing off it can bring about withdrawal symptoms much greater than even heroin withdrawal. Methadone is a full opioid agonist, similar to heroin. However, it's effects last much longer which is why the withdrawal from it can be so harsh and last so long. And considering methadone can stay in the body for such a long time, users may not even start feeling the effects of withdrawal for a day or two when they stop taking it cold turkey. Methadone withdrawal is similar to that of other opiates, and feels similar to a really bad flu and may include chills, fever, profuse sweating, nausea and vomiting, muscle and bone aches and pain, stomach cramping, extreme insomnia, etc.

Methadone withdrawal can be made more comfortable and manageable in a detox facility which accepts methadone clients. Some facilities offer a medication assisted detoxification while others help the individual detox from the drug without the use of controlled medications.
